1 /*
2  * Hisilicon clock driver
3  *
4  * Copyright (c) 2013-2017 Hisilicon Limited.
5  * Copyright (c) 2017 Linaro Limited.
6  *
7  * Author: Kai Zhao <zhaokai1@hisilicon.com>
8  *          Tao Wang <kevin.wangtao@hisilicon.com>
9  *          Leo Yan <leo.yan@linaro.org>
10  *
11  * This program is free software; you can redistribute it and/or modify
12  * it under the terms of the GNU General Public License as published by
13  * the Free Software Foundation; either version 2 of the License, or
14  * (at your option) any later version.
15  *
16  * This program is distributed in the hope that it will be useful,
17  * but WITHOUT ANY WARRANTY; without even the implied warranty of
18  *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E.  See the
19  * GNU General Public License for more details.
20  *
21  */
22
23 #include <linux/clk-provider.h>
24 #include <linux/device.h>
25 #include <linux/err.h>
26 #include <linux/init.h>
27 #include <linux/mailbox_client.h>
28 #include <linux/module.h>
29 #include <linux/of.h>
30 #include <linux/platform_device.h>
31 #include <dt-bindings/clock/hi3660-clock.h>
32
33 #define HI3660_STUB_CLOCK_DATA          (0x70)
34 #define MHZ                             (1000 * 1000)
35
36 #define DEFINE_CLK_STUB(_id, _cmd, _name)                       \
37         {                                                       \
38                 .id = (_id),                                    \
39                 .cmd = (_cmd),                                  \
40                 .hw.init = &(struct clk_init_data) {            \
41                         .name = #_name,                         \
42                         .ops = &hi3660_stub_clk_ops,            \
43                         .num_parents = 0,                       \
44                         .flags = CLK_GET_RATE_NOCACHE,          \
45                 },                                              \
46         },
47
48 #define to_stub_clk(_hw) container_of(_hw, struct hi3660_stub_clk, hw)
49
50 struct hi3660_stub_clk_chan {
51         struct mbox_client cl;
52         struct mbox_chan *mbox;
53 };
54
55 struct hi3660_stub_clk {
56         unsigned int id;
57         struct clk_hw hw;
58         unsigned int cmd;
59         unsigned int msg[8];
60         unsigned int rate;
61 };
62
63 static void __iomem *freq_reg;
64 static struct hi3660_stub_clk_chan stub_clk_chan;
65
66 static unsigned long hi3660_stub_clk_recalc_rate(struct clk_hw *hw,
67                                                  unsigned long parent_rate)
68 {
69         struct hi3660_stub_clk *stub_clk = to_stub_clk(hw);
70
71         /*
72          * LPM3 writes back the CPU frequency in shared SRAM so read
73          * back the frequency.
74          */
75         stub_clk->rate = readl(freq_reg + (stub_clk->id << 2)) * MHZ;
76         return stub_clk->rate;
77 }
78
79 static long hi3660_stub_clk_round_rate(struct clk_hw *hw, unsigned long rate,
80                                        unsigned long *prate)
81 {
82         /*
83          * LPM3 handles rate rounding so just return whatever
84          * rate is requested.
85          */
86         return rate;
87 }
88
89 static int hi3660_stub_clk_set_rate(struct clk_hw *hw, unsigned long rate,
90                                     unsigned long parent_rate)
91 {
92         struct hi3660_stub_clk *stub_clk = to_stub_clk(hw);
93
94         stub_clk->msg[0] = stub_clk->cmd;
95         stub_clk->msg[1] = rate / MHZ;
96
97         dev_dbg(stub_clk_chan.cl.dev, "set rate msg[0]=0x%x msg[1]=0x%x\n",
98                 stub_clk->msg[0], stub_clk->msg[1]);
99
100         mbox_send_message(stub_clk_chan.mbox, stub_clk->msg);
101         mbox_client_txdone(stub_clk_chan.mbox, 0);
102
103         stub_clk->rate = rate;
104         return 0;
105 }
106
107 static const struct clk_ops hi3660_stub_clk_ops = {
108         .recalc_rate    = hi3660_stub_clk_recalc_rate,
109         .round_rate     = hi3660_stub_clk_round_rate,
110         .set_rate       = hi3660_stub_clk_set_rate,
111 };
112
113 static struct hi3660_stub_clk hi3660_stub_clks[HI3660_CLK_STUB_NUM] = {
114         DEFINE_CLK_STUB(HI3660_CLK_STUB_CLUSTER0, 0x0001030A, "cpu-cluster.0")
115         DEFINE_CLK_STUB(HI3660_CLK_STUB_CLUSTER1, 0x0002030A, "cpu-cluster.1")
116         DEFINE_CLK_STUB(HI3660_CLK_STUB_GPU, 0x0003030A, "clk-g3d")
117         DEFINE_CLK_STUB(HI3660_CLK_STUB_DDR, 0x00040309, "clk-ddrc")
118 };
119
120 static struct clk_hw *hi3660_stub_clk_hw_get(struct of_phandle_args *clkspec,
121                                              void *data)
122 {
123         unsigned int idx = clkspec->args[0];
124
125         if (idx >= HI3660_CLK_STUB_NUM) {
126                 pr_err("%s: invalid index %u\n", __func__, idx);
127                 return ERR_PTR(-EINVAL);
128         }
129
130         return &hi3660_stub_clks[idx].hw;
131 }
132
133 static int hi3660_stub_clk_probe(struct platform_device *pdev)
134 {
135         struct device *dev = &pdev->dev;
136         struct resource *res;
137         unsigned int i;
138         int ret;
139
140         /* Use mailbox client without blocking */
141         stub_clk_chan.cl.dev = dev;
142         stub_clk_chan.cl.tx_done = NULL;
143         stub_clk_chan.cl.tx_block = false;
144         stub_clk_chan.cl.knows_txdone = false;
145
146         /* Allocate mailbox channel */
147         stub_clk_chan.mbox = mbox_request_channel(&stub_clk_chan.cl, 0);
148         if (IS_ERR(stub_clk_chan.mbox))
149                 return PTR_ERR(stub_clk_chan.mbox);
150
151         res = platform_get_resource(pdev, IORESOURCE_MEM, 0);
152         if (!res)
153                 return -EINVAL;
154         freq_reg = devm_ioremap(dev, res->start, resource_size(res));
155         if (!freq_reg)
156                 return -ENOMEM;
157
158         freq_reg += HI3660_STUB_CLOCK_DATA;
159
160         for (i = 0; i < HI3660_CLK_STUB_NUM; i++) {
161                 ret = devm_clk_hw_register(&pdev->dev, &hi3660_stub_clks[i].hw);
162                 if (ret)
163                         return ret;
164         }
165
166         return devm_of_clk_add_hw_provider(&pdev->dev, hi3660_stub_clk_hw_get,
167                                            hi3660_stub_clks);
168 }
169
170 static const struct of_device_id hi3660_stub_clk_of_match[] = {
171         { .compatible = "hisilicon,hi3660-stub-clk", },
172         {}
173 };
174
175 static struct platform_driver hi3660_stub_clk_driver = {
176         .probe  = hi3660_stub_clk_probe,
177         .driver = {
178                 .name = "hi3660-stub-clk",
179                 .of_match_table = hi3660_stub_clk_of_match,
180         },
181 };
182
183 static int __init hi3660_stub_clk_init(void)
184 {
185         return platform_driver_register(&hi3660_stub_clk_driver);
186 }
